It's August 2015 and the threat of world war 3 is weighing heavily on the people of Sheffield, but not on Lavender Fray. For Kyle Robinson, the "cute" son of the owner of the restaurant where she and her mother work, has told her he loves her. Her mother is afraid they'll both lose their jobs but Lavender is prepared to risk everything for Kyle's love. Michael Robinson is furious when he finds out his son is involved with a cook and they become locked in a fierce battle. Fired with the fever of patriotism and determined to defy his father, Kyle becomes a soldier and goes of to fight in America. Lavender is left facing what seem to be unconquerable obstacles but with the help of her friends, family and a strength she never knew she had she struggles on while the widening tragedy of the fighting in America unfold. It's not until the fighting is overt hat she finds peace, and even then it's not where she expected it.
